游戏平台的技术架构:稳定性和扩展性的平衡

2025-07-26 09:00 浏览

游戏平台的技术架构:稳定性和扩展性的平衡

随着网络技术的飞速发展,游戏平台作为娱乐产业的重要组成部分,其技术架构的稳定性和扩展性成为了关键要素。本文将探讨游戏平台技术架构中稳定性和扩展性的平衡问题,以期为相关从业者提供有价值的参考。


一、游戏平台技术架构概述

游戏平台技术架构是支撑游戏运行的核心框架,涉及到数据存储、网络通信、服务器集群、安全防护等多个方面。一个优秀的游戏平台技术架构需要确保游戏的稳定运行,同时还要具备良好的扩展性,以适应不断增长的用户需求和业务变化。


二、稳定性的重要性

稳定性是游戏平台技术架构的首要目标。一个不稳定的游戏平台可能导致游戏掉线、数据丢失、服务器崩溃等问题,严重影响用户体验和游戏运营。为了实现稳定性,游戏平台技术架构需要采取一系列措施,如优化网络架构、提高服务器容错能力、定期维护和备份等。


三、扩展性的考虑

随着游戏用户数量的不断增长和业务的不断拓展,游戏平台需要具备良好的扩展性,以适应不断变化的市场需求。扩展性涉及到资源扩展、功能扩展和地域扩展等方面。为了实现良好的扩展性,游戏平台技术架构需要采用微服务架构、云计算技术、负载均衡等技术手段,以提高系统的可伸缩性和灵活性。

四、稳定性和扩展性的平衡

稳定性和扩展性在游戏平台技术架构中是相互制约、相互影响的。过度追求稳定性可能导致系统缺乏灵活性,难以适应业务变化;而过度追求扩展性则可能导致系统稳定性下降,增加运维难度。因此,在游戏平台技术架构设计中,需要综合考虑稳定性和扩展性的需求,寻求二者之间的平衡。

为了实现稳定性和扩展性的平衡,游戏平台技术架构需要采取以下策略:

  1. 模块化设计:将系统划分为不同的模块,每个模块负责特定的功能,降低模块之间的耦合度,提高系统的可维护性和可扩展性。
  2. 分布式架构:采用分布式架构,将系统部署在多个服务器上,提高系统的容错能力和可扩展性。
  3. 自动化运维:通过自动化运维工具,实现对系统的实时监控、自动扩缩容、故障自动恢复等功能,提高系统的稳定性和扩展性。
  4. 持续优化:根据业务需求和用户反馈,持续优化系统性能,平衡稳定性和扩展性的需求。

五、总结

游戏平台技术架构的稳定性和扩展性是保障游戏运营和用户体验的关键要素。在实现技术架构时,需要综合考虑稳定性和扩展性的需求,采取合适的策略和技术手段,以实现二者之间的平衡。随着技术的不断发展和市场需求的不断变化,游戏平台技术架构需要持续优化和升级,以适应不断变化的市场环境。

关注找手游微信公众号,了解手游代理最新资讯



客服中心

刘先生:
18372019116

添加微信好友获取行业干货

分享: